Slegengr Posted October 7, 2014 Posted October 7, 2014 I also think you did a nice job on this vegetable field. The pumpkins are excellent. One note, since I have considered this in my own build: Corn ears grow out of the side of the stalk near the middle, rather than out of the top of the stalk. I noticed this also because I live in the heart of the corn belt in the USA, so have seen corn on a regular basis for my entire life. To implement this, I used a similar stalk strategy to yours with cones slid over a stem on the 3-stem grass piece near the middle. I do not intend that you need to fix this, as I do not think GoH needs to be founded 100% on reality, but this was something I noticed. Nice build and nice base for the build! Quote
